在Qt中如何通过编程实现数据库事务的提交和回滚操作?请提供具体的代码示例。
时间: 2024-11-13 11:32:30 浏览: 4
在Qt中操作数据库事务是保证数据一致性和完整性的关键步骤。为了帮助你掌握如何在Qt环境下通过代码实现数据库事务的提交(commit)和回滚(rollback),推荐查看这份资料:《Qt事务操作教程:掌握数据库一致性与界面开发》。这份资源将为你提供详细的操作指南和实例,直接关联到你当前的问题。
参考资源链接:[Qt事务操作教程:掌握数据库一致性与界面开发](https://wenku.csdn.net/doc/19b7u20jyc?spm=1055.2569.3001.10343)
在Qt中,数据库事务处理通常涉及`QSqlDatabase`类及其相关方法。首先,需要确保已经正确配置数据库连接。一旦建立了连接,就可以开始事务操作。以下是实现事务提交和回滚的代码示例:
```cpp
QSqlDatabase db = QSqlDatabase::addDatabase(
参考资源链接:[Qt事务操作教程:掌握数据库一致性与界面开发](https://wenku.csdn.net/doc/19b7u20jyc?spm=1055.2569.3001.10343)
阅读全文